Meg lives in a remote part of Michigan's Upper Peninsula with her husband, four young children and several fur babies. She shares glimpses of her life, a collection of mainly fine art, environmental portraiture and lifestyle photography, on her personal Instagram account.  Her muses are her children, but she is also inspired by nature, the Dutch Masters, the Renaissance and Norman Rockwell.
Meg is a Sigma Ambassador and Profoto Legend of Light, as well as an internationally-renowned teacher. She is also a volunteer photographer for The Gold Hope Project, a non-profit organization that gifts pediatric cancer families a free photo session.

The studio is located at The Arsenal, a bohemian artist's enclave in Benicia, California. Rich in history and artistic inspiration, The Arsenal is best described as a photographer's dream. The studio and gallery boast 30-foot ceilings, with huge windows throughout. A selection of well-curated props and furnishings are used within the luminous space but photographic possibilities extend beyond the walls of the primary studio, providing endless variations in photographic styling.  Simply put...there is no single place in the San Francisco Bay Area where you can go for a photo session and get so much variety in one session.

Jennine is a kid at heart who takes a sophisticated approach to baby, child, and family photography.    Jennine began her photography journey at Brooks Institute of Santa Barbara before taking the traditional assisting route to learn photography.  Jennine's work has been featured by premium brands and organizations including the March of Dimes, Crate and Barrel, Janie and Jack, Elestory and Inspired Magazine and Click Magazine.  As mother to 4, Jennine considers 'Mom' to be her most important title and has built her business around that guiding principle.
